A podcast dedicated to helping people find freedom from themselves.

The Free Me From Me Podcast is a conversation about the invisible battles we all face—the ones that quietly shape our relationships, our faith, and the way we see ourselves.

Inspired by Ryan Wekenman's book Free Me From Me, each episode features a guest from a different decade of life (20s, 30s, 40s, 50+) who shares how one of the four layers of the "Me-Maze"—the Performer, Comparer, Avoider, or Controller—has influenced their story.

Through honest conversations, laughter, vulnerability, and biblical truth, you'll discover that while our struggles may look different in every season of life, God's invitation to freedom remains the same.

Whether you're trying to prove yourself, comparing your life to everyone else's, avoiding what matters most, or gripping tightly for control, this podcast will help you recognize the patterns keeping you stuck—and point you toward the freedom Christ offers.
